What is Confluence?

Editorial review
Confluence is the wiki for Atlassian shops. If you use Jira, Confluence connects documentation to tickets. Teams create spaces for projects, write pages with rich content, and build knowledge bases. The editor handles complex content. Integrations with Atlassian products are seamless. Enterprise features satisfy larger organizations. Teams invested in Atlassian's ecosystem use Confluence because it's the documentation tool designed to work with the rest of their stack.

Pricing Plans

Free Trial

Free

Free

  • Up to 10 users
  • 2GB storage
  • Basic features
  • 3 active whiteboards/user
  • 10 automation rules/month

Standard

$6.4/monthly

  • Per user for up to 100
  • Decreases with scale
  • 100 automation rules/month
  • Business hours support
  • Unlimited spaces

Premium

$12.3/monthly

  • Per user for 100+
  • Unlimited whiteboards
  • 24/7 premium support
  • 1-hour response SLA
  • Advanced analytics

Enterprise

Contact sales

  • Custom pricing
  • Multiple sites
  • Advanced security
  • SSO and compliance
  • Dedicated support

Confluence FAQ

Is Confluence better than Notion?

Confluence is better for Jira integration and structured documentation. Notion is more flexible and modern. Choose based on your tech stack.

Can Confluence replace SharePoint?

Yes, Confluence can replace SharePoint for team wikis and documentation. It's more developer-friendly and integrates better with Atlassian tools.
